How the Ranking of the Most Advanced Fighter Jets Is Changing

The ranking of the most advanced fighter jets continues to evolve as air forces modernize fleets, integrate new sensors, and field upgraded weapons. As of 2025, only a handful of nations operate true fifth-generation platforms, while several others deploy high-end fourth-plus generation aircraft with advanced avionics and limited stealth. This report provides an updated, fact-driven assessment of today’s most capable fighters currently in operational service.

The ranking below is based on publicly available data regarding stealth characteristics, sensor fusion, range, weapons integration, electronic warfare (EW), and operational maturity.

The Top 10 Most Advanced Fighter Jets in Active Service (2025)

1. Lockheed Martin F-35 Lightning II (USA) — The Global Benchmark

The F-35 remains the most widely deployed fifth-generation fighter, operated by more than a dozen allied air forces. Its strength lies in its fused sensor suite, advanced AESA radar, low-observable design, secure datalinks, and extensive weapons certification. Ongoing upgrades under the Block 4 modernization program expand its electronic attack capabilities and enable new long-range strike options.

2. Lockheed Martin F-22 Raptor (USA) — Air Superiority Standard

Although produced in limited numbers, the F-22 remains unmatched in high-end air dominance missions. Its superior stealth, agility, supercruise performance, and integrated EW suite keep it at the top tier. The Raptor’s sensors and avionics continue to receive upgrades to maintain relevance against modern threats.

3. Chengdu J-20 Mighty Dragon (China)

China’s first operational fifth-generation fighter has entered mass production, with the latest “J-20B” variants reportedly fielding improved engines and avionics. Its large internal volume supports long-range missions in the Indo-Pacific, and its evolving sensor suite enhances situational awareness. Operational details remain classified, but the aircraft is now firmly established in front-line service.

4. Sukhoi Su-57 Felon (Russia)

Russia’s Su-57 combines stealth shaping, supermaneuverability, and multi-role capability. While fleet numbers remain limited, the aircraft is actively deployed within the Russian Aerospace Forces. Its low-observable signature is less mature than U.S. or Chinese designs, but its advanced IRST and EW systems contribute to its ranking.

5. Eurofighter Typhoon (Europe) — Fully Mature 4.5-Gen Platform

Operated by the UK, Germany, Italy, Spain, and several export customers, the Typhoon’s latest Tranche 3 and ECR variants offer upgraded radars, expanded weapons integration, and strong electronic attack capability. Its high-altitude performance and reliability make it one of the leading non-stealth fighters.

6. Dassault Rafale F3R/F4 (France)

The Rafale combines multi-role flexibility with advanced avionics, AESA radar, and cutting-edge EW systems (SPECTRA). The F4 standard enhances connectivity, weapons accuracy, and sensor performance, solidifying its position as a top-tier European fighter.

7. Boeing F-15EX Eagle II (USA)

Built on the proven F-15 lineage, the F-15EX introduces digital fly-by-wire controls, an advanced EPAWSS EW suite, and the world’s highest air-to-air weapons capacity. It lacks stealth but excels in payload, speed, and long-range combat.

8. Saab JAS 39E/F Gripen (Sweden)

Designed for network-centric warfare, the Gripen E/F features the PS-05/A Mk5 radar suite, low operating costs, and a strong electronic warfare package. It is among the most cost-efficient high-performance fighters in service.

9. F-16V “Viper” Upgrade (USA / Allied Operators)

The F-16V represents the latest and most advanced configuration of the F-16 family. It incorporates an AESA radar, upgraded mission computer, modern cockpit displays, and advanced weapons — extending the operational relevance of this long-serving platform.

10. KAI KF-21 Boramae (South Korea) — Early Operational Entry

Although still in its formative operational stages, the KF-21 entered limited service with the Republic of Korea Air Force. Its capabilities — AESA radar, advanced sensors, and a modular open architecture — position it as one of the most promising future 4.5-generation designs.

Factors That Determine Fighter Jet Ranking

To evaluate the ranking of the most advanced fighter jets, several core criteria were applied:

Stealth & Survivability

Low-observable design and advanced EW systems significantly influence survivability in denied-airspace environments.

Sensors, Fusion, and Targeting

Platforms that integrate radar, IRST, EW, and communications into a unified display offer superior situational awareness.

Weapons Capability

Air-to-air missiles, stand-off weapons, precision strike systems, and integration flexibility are key differentiators.

Operational Maturity

Platforms with proven readiness, reliable maintenance cycles, and global deployment scores higher.

Analysis: Strategic Implications of the Current Rankings

The concentration of fifth-generation aircraft among a small group of nations shapes global airpower balance. The U.S. maintains a decisive advantage through the combined strength of the F-22 and F-35 fleets, supported by a robust industry and upgrade pipeline.

China’s J-20 is rapidly maturing, contributing to shifting dynamics in the Indo-Pacific and compelling regional states to accelerate modernization programs. Europe continues to rely on 4.5-generation fighters while preparing for sixth-generation partnerships such as FCAS and GCAP.

The presence of advanced but non-stealth platforms like the F-15EX illustrates that speed, payload, and EW capabilities still play critical roles in multi-domain operations, especially where stealth is not the primary factor.

Basis for Ranking: Why the F-35 Is No. 1 and the KF-21 Is No. 10

Why the F-35 Ranks #1

The F-35 is evaluated as the most advanced fighter jet in active service due to:

  • Full fifth-generation stealth performance
  • Mature sensor fusion and situational awareness
  • Widest deployment among allied air forces
  • Advanced electronic warfare and data-link systems
  • Block 4 upgrade pathway expanding weapons and capabilities
  • Proven operational record across multiple regions

These factors collectively position the F-35 as the top combat aircraft currently fielded anywhere in the world.

Why the KF-21 Ranks #10

The KF-21 Boramae is placed at Number 10 because:

  • It is operational only in limited early deployment
  • It is classified as a 4.5-generation fighter, not fifth-generation
  • Its stealth characteristics are partial, not full-spectrum
  • Weapons and avionics integration are still expanding
  • Export and combat readiness remain unproven

However, it ranks within the top 10 because:

  • It features modern AESA radar and sensor architecture
  • It is designed with open systems for rapid upgrades
  • It represents one of the most advanced emerging platforms

The KF-21 is considered a future growth aircraft, but as of 2025, it ranks below mature systems like the Rafale, Typhoon, and F-15EX.

FAQs

What is the most advanced fighter jet in service today?

The F-35 is considered the most advanced due to its sensor fusion, stealth, and global operational maturity.

Which countries operate fifth-generation fighters?

The United States, China, and Russia are the only nations with operational, indigenous fifth-generation aircraft.

Is the Su-57 fully deployed?

Yes, but in limited numbers. Russia continues incremental deliveries and capability upgrades.

How does the J-20 compare to the F-22?

The F-22 remains superior in air dominance, but the J-20 offers longer range and is improving rapidly.

Is the KF-21 considered a fifth-generation jet?

Not yet — it is classified as a 4.5-generation platform, though it may gain low-observable features in future blocks.
